In "The Marriage Plot" by Jeffrey Eugenides, a character experiences a profound moment of realization triggered by the overwhelming impact of language. The sheer weight and authority of the words around her momentarily halt her, creating a powerful pause in her emotional journey. This encounter emphasizes the significant role that literature and language play in shaping one's understanding of love and relationships.
The quote highlights how words can possess a commanding force, influencing feelings and thoughts in a compelling way. It reflects the character's internal struggle and the complexity of navigating her emotions while being surrounded by the potency of literary expression. This moment serves as a reminder of the transformative power of literature in our lives.
